Nightbane

by Alex Aster · Lightlark #2 · 416 pages · Published August 2023
Spoiler-light guide Series order included Similar books included
2.70 / 5 across 15K ratings
Spice: 🌶️🌶️ (2/5)

A dark, romantic Young Adult ya romantasy built around betrayal, dark powers, enemies. 416 pages with a gentle romantic thread and a satisfying conclusion.

Is Nightbane spicy?

Low heat (2/5) — some tension and mild scenes.

Do I need to read Nightbane in order?

Nightbane is book 2 in the Lightlark series. Reading in order is recommended.

Who would enjoy Nightbane?

Readers who love dark and romantic stories with betrayal and dark powers. Best suited for Young Adult readers and up.
